Haven’t been on here in a while and would like to start being more active again. lol so here’s how the rigs sits today. I upgraded to marlin dual case. Being that I won the GP at mcr won a set of gears and the dual case adaptor. And after breaking axle shaft and rear RPs I ditched the Toyota axles and now running 1 tons. 14 bolt rear and d60 KP in the front with 40s. 5.38 gears and Detroit rear and arb front. Also running full hydro. I’ll post some pics along the way of doing that. Still the 3.0v6 for now.

Just picked up a 3.4 engine with all its wiring harness and intake/exhaust manifolds for $200 the engine is seized tho. So I’m going to slowly build up parts and build the engine. Question is I would like to supercharge it. But the price for a supercharger is crazy. Would the added power be worth it ?
